What are the Different Types of EV Charging?

Electric vehicles can be charged using various methods suited to different scenarios:

  • Level 1 Charging (AC EV Charger): Uses a standard 120V outlet and is typically reserved for overnight use or when faster charging options are not available.
  • Level 2 Charging (AC EV Charger): Requires a 240V supply and reduces charging times significantly, making it ideal for both home and public use.
  • DC Fast Charging (Level 3 Charging): Provides rapid charging capabilities, suitable for quick top-ups at public charging stations, and can charge an EV battery to 80% in about 30 minutes.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best type of EV charger for home use?

For most home users, Level 2 chargers offer the best balance between speed and convenience. They can be installed where there is access to a 240V system, providing a faster charge than Level 1 chargers.

Can Type 1 and Type 2 chargers be used interchangeably?

Type 1 and Type 2 chargers are not interchangeable due to different plug designs and electrical specifications. Vehicles are typically compatible with one type based on regional standards and manufacturer specifications.

How do I choose the right EV charger for my business?

Consider the typical usage scenarios of your customers. For high-traffic areas where quick turnover is needed, DC Fast Chargers are preferable. For locations where vehicles can be parked for longer durations, such as overnight at hotels or during work hours at offices, Level 2 chargers may be more appropriate.

What are the safety standards for EV chargers?

All EV chargers should comply with local electrical safety standards and regulations. Additionally, look for chargers that offer features like ground fault protection, overcurrent protection, and real-time monitoring for maximum safety.
